C. Körner, I. Janusch, W. Kropatsch:
"Noise Robustness of Irregular Graph Pyramids using LBP and Combinatorial Maps";
Talk: OAGM/AAPR & ARW 2016 Workshop, Wels, Österreich (invited); 2016-05-11 - 2016-05-13; in: "Vision Meets Robotics, Proceedings of the ÖAGM Workshop 2016", K. Niel, W. Burger (ed.); Wels, Austria (2016), 101 - 108.



English abstract:
In this paper, we briefly introduce the SCIS algorithm - a hierarchical image segmentation approach
based on LBP pyramids - and evaluate its robustness to uniform, Gaussian, and Poisson distributed
additive chromatic noise. Moreover, we study the influence of image properties such as the amount
of details and SNR on the segmentation performance. Our evaluation shows that SCIS is robust to
Gaussian and Poisson noise for our testing environment.
